Walter Roberson
il 11 Nov 2016
For example you can take
data_in_ROI = YourData(ROI_mask);
data_outside_ROI = YourData(~ROI_mask);
compressed_mask = run_length_encode_bitwise(ROI_mask);
compressed_inside = lossless_compression(data_in_ROI);
compressed_outside = lossy_compression(data_outside_ROI);
compressed_result = [compressed_mask, compressed_inside, compressed_outside];
Restoration would be decoding the compressed result to separate the parts, then uncompressing the mask, uncompressing the losslessly-compressed inside data, storing it in the positions where the mask is true, uncompressing the lossy outside data, storing that in the positions where the mask is false.
